Chicken Binakol
Chicken Binakol is a savory Filipino stew where chicken is cooked in a coconut-based broth with fresh vegetables and sometimes herbs. Its slightly sweet flavor from the coconut makes it a deliciously comforting dish.
Instructions
Heat the cooking oil in a large cooking pot. Sauté the garlic, onion, and ginger until the onion softens.
Add the chicken and 3 tablespoons of fish sauce (note: you can add more fish sauce later as needed). Continue sautéing until the chicken turns light brown in color (around 3 to 4 minutes).
Pour in the juice of the young coconut (buko juice), and then add the coconut meat. Let it boil.
Add the green papaya and lemongrass. Cover and simmer for 20 to 30 minutes. (Note: you can also add water as needed.)
Put the long green peppers in the pot and season with ground black pepper. Continue cooking for 3 minutes.
Add the Maggi Magic Chicken Cube. Stir and turn off the heat.
Add the hot pepper leaves and malunggay leaves. Stir and let the residual heat cook them for 2 minutes.
Transfer to a serving bowl. Serve hot. Share and enjoy!
